Edward Charles Moore, born November 22, 1933, in Clinton, IA, formerly of Chicago, IL, died at home on Monday, January 8, 2001. His parents, James C. and Helen I. Moore, preceded him. Edward served in the U.S. Air Force from 1952 to 1955 and received Bachelor and Master degrees from the University of Chicago. He retired from the Illinois Cook County School System in 1994 after 26 years as a middle school teacher and moved to Albuquerque, NM in 1998. Edward was also an avid motorcyclist. He is survived by his wife Eileen; daughter, Anna (by a previous marriage), of Chicago; two brothers; two nieces, four nephews; and five grandnices and grandnephews. Services will be held Saturday, 1:30 p.m. at Immanuel Lutheran Church, 300 Gold Ave. SE, Albuquerque, NM, with Randy Walquist officiating. Interment will follow at Sunset Memorial Park, 924 Menaul Blvd. NE, Albuquerque, NM. Should friends desire, memorial contributions may be made to Immanuel Lutheran School, 300 Gold Ave. SE, Albuquerque, NM 87102. French Mortuary, 1111 University Blvd., NE.
